Hey guys,

I am trying to recover 8Tb after a raid failure. RAID issues seem to
be resolved, but cannot mount the fs,

dmesg says:
 EXT4-fs (md127): bad geometry: block count 1953512448 exceeds size of
device (1953509376 blocks)

OS sees ext4

have complete dd back of fs, so I can kick it around

debugfs cannot see fs structure.

fsck tried to fix every inode, but at 500M inodes (and would take a
month to complete), that far exceeds used inodes

Am I beating a dead horse here, or is there some hope for recovery?
